LED (light-emitting diode) technology has revolutionized stage lighting, offering an unparalleled combination of energy savings and brightness. Compared to traditional incandescent bulbs, LEDs consume up to 80% less energy while emitting the same or even greater illumination. This translates into significant reductions in electricity bills over time.
Moreover, LEDs boast an extended lifespan of up to 100,000 hours, far exceeding that of conventional bulbs. By eliminating the need for frequent bulb replacements, venues minimize downtime, labor costs, and the potential for accidents associated with changing high fixtures.
Energy-efficient stage lighting not only benefits the environment but also contributes to a safer and more sustainable work environment. Traditional lighting generates excessive heat, leading to increased air conditioning costs and discomfort for performers and crew. In contrast, LED lighting emits significantly less heat, reducing the need for cooling and improving the overall working conditions.
Furthermore, implementing smart lighting control systems allows for precise adjustment of light levels and color temperatures according to the needs of the production. This eliminates unnecessary energy wastage and enhances the visual impact of performances. Additionally, energy monitoring systems can track energy consumption in real-time, enabling venues to identify areas for further optimization.
